Intel Celeron 4205U vs AMD Ryzen 5 3450U

We compared two laptop CPUs: Intel Celeron 4205U with 2 cores 1.8GHz and AMD Ryzen 5 3450U with 4 cores 2.1G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

AMD Ryzen 5 3450U 's Advantages
Released 1 years late
Better graphics card performance
Higher specification of memory (DDR4-2400 vs DDR4-2133)
Larger memory bandwidth (38.4GB/s vs 37.5GB/s)
Newer PCIe version (3.0 vs 2.0)
Higher base frequency (2.1GHz vs 1.8GHz)
Larger L3 cache size (4MB vs 2MB)
Lower TDP (12W vs 15W)
